STUCK! - Where do i get to the castle???

Post by Skylar »

I have talked to Anorwyn now and i need to get the stone and to the castle i guess, but cannot find the way in. I found the altar for the stone and on my map it shows a entry same place as the altar is - i just cannot seem to find an entry anywhere??

Spoilers Highlight to see


Before you can gain entrance to the castle you must first find a new Gem of the Weave. After talking with Annorrweyn(assuming you freed the Baelnorn down the the Drow Catacombs) you must go to Ironbar at the House of Gems and he will give you instuctions to acquire a new Gem. Once you have the Gem return to Annorrweyn and you will know what to do next. There is no direct entry to the castle the first time, you will have to do this for Annorrweyn and she will deal with the rest. :)
